OpenAI Unveils Sora: AI Video Model for Realistic Text-To-Video Creation


Core Concepts
OpenAI introduces Sora, an advanced AI video model capable of transforming text prompts into minute-long videos, emphasizing safety and addressing potential limitations.
Abstract
OpenAI revealed Sora, a generative AI model that can produce detailed videos from text prompts. The model showcases intricate scenes, camera movements, and emotional characters. However, OpenAI is cautious about releasing Sora due to safety concerns and its need for further testing in areas like misinformation and bias. Despite its capabilities, the model may struggle with simulating complex physics or understanding cause and effect instances. OpenAI aims to engage with various stakeholders to address concerns before making Sora publicly available.

How might the introduction of AI video models like Sora impact the entertainment industry?

The introduction of AI video models like Sora could have a significant impact on the entertainment industry. These advanced AI models can streamline and revolutionize content creation processes by generating high-quality videos from simple text prompts, potentially reducing production costs and time. This technology could enable filmmakers, animators, and content creators to explore new creative possibilities, experiment with different visual styles, and bring their ideas to life more efficiently. Additionally, AI-generated videos could open up opportunities for personalized content creation tailored to individual preferences or targeted audience segments. However, there may also be concerns about job displacement in traditional production roles as automation becomes more prevalent in the industry.

What ethical considerations should be taken into account when developing advanced AI models like Sora?

When developing advanced AI models like Sora, several ethical considerations must be taken into account to ensure responsible use of this technology. Firstly, transparency is crucial – developers should clearly disclose that the content has been generated by an AI model to avoid misleading audiences. Secondly, issues related to bias and fairness need careful attention; developers must actively work towards mitigating biases present in training data that could perpetuate harmful stereotypes or discrimination in the generated content. Privacy concerns arise when personal data is used to train these models; therefore, robust data protection measures must be implemented to safeguard user information. Moreover, ensuring accountability for any potential misuse of AI-generated content is essential through clear guidelines on acceptable use cases and consequences for unethical behavior.

How can the legal battles surrounding copyright issues influence the future of AI technology?

The legal battles surrounding copyright issues have significant implications for the future development and deployment of AI technology. As seen with OpenAI's disputes over alleged copyright infringement in using authors' works without permission for training its language models such as ChatGPT or Sora's video generation capabilities based on copyrighted material - these conflicts highlight complex intellectual property challenges arising from utilizing third-party content in machine learning algorithms. Such legal battles underscore the importance of establishing clearer regulations around intellectual property rights within the context of rapidly advancing technologies like artificial intelligence. These disputes may lead companies investing in research & development (R&D) efforts involving large datasets derived from copyrighted sources -to adopt stricter compliance measures regarding licensing agreements or seek alternative methods such as synthetic data generation techniques- thus shaping how organizations navigate legal landscapes while innovating with cutting-edge technologies like advanced AIs. Furthermore- ongoing litigation outcomes will likely set precedents influencing future practices concerning fair use doctrines- licensing agreements between tech firms & original creators- ultimately impacting how innovation thrives amidst evolving legal frameworks governing digital creations powered by artificial intelligence systems."
